Hey guys!

 

It's been 3 months since I last posted and I've got quite a lot to share since then....

 

I've had quite a bit more growth come in, mostly in the crown since month 6 and am quite happy with the results I have right now...

 

I did hit a snag about 8.5 months in however...here's the story behind that:

 

I had begun experiencing sides from Propecia about 2 1/2 - 3 months in but decided to ride it out thinking that they would subside...

 

They didn't.

 

Despite me taking many supplements to offset the sides(L-Arginine @ 3000mg, Yohimbine & Horny Goat Weed @ 900mg each, Ginkgo Biloba @ 800mg) and in addition to me doing Heavy weightlifting 3x a week and cardio 2-3 times a week, the libido was stilll lacking.

 

I didn't want to sacrifice one aspect of my life for the other so I began weening myself off of proscar....taking .6mg a day, then down to .6mg every 4 or so days...I got to a point where I had been off it for a little over a week even. The good news was I felt GREAT! The sexual energy was back, I was no longer at a point where once a week or even no desire throughout the week was the scenario...BUT...My hair had started falling out(10-15 hairs a day at one point).

 

So, I got back on proscar and in the meantime I ordered some Avodart...

 

As a result, I lost a bit of hair in the crown and mid region of my scalp, not sure about the temples...but hopefully I'll regrow what fell out, and more importantly to me, hopefully I will not have any sides with Avodart and can continue to use an internal medication..

 

***NOTE***

The above is my PERSONAL experience with taking Propecia and doing all that is within my power to offset the sides. In my personal experience, the sides are an unquestionable reality, however I cannot say this will be the case for YOU. I cannot speak for how you will respond to it. Take what you will from my testimony, but in the end, the only way to see how YOU will respond is to test it out for yourself.

***************

 

So as a result of all this...I've decided to delay the plans for a second hair transplant and see how my ordeal with the meds goes...

 

Enjoy the progress pics!

 

-Mike
